Huge thanks to @aidenybai for React Grab! it’s awesome-sauce 💜 Was finding a non-blocking way to use it, so I built a Chrome extension to toggle it per‑tab (CSP‑safe, no data collection). Open source! Codebase: github.com/rakeshmenon/re… (it's unofficial of course) @aidenybai…

The security vulnerability we found in Perplexity’s Comet browser this summer is not an isolated issue. Indirect prompt injections are a systemic problem facing Comet and other AI-powered browsers. Today we’re publishing details on more security vulnerabilities we uncovered.
